  2. Dashboards as Code

    Build dashboards entirely in code (git-based, LLM-friendly) Define and manage Embeddable dashboards entirely in code - without any no-code builder interaction - so you can store dashboards in git alongside components and data models, and iterate on them using LLM tools like Claude Code, Cursor, and Codex. The workflow: Define components, themes, data models and dashboards as code in your repoUse embeddable:dev to preview and hot-reload changes in the browser as you iterateUse LLM coding tools to modify dashboards via the terminal (updating layouts, inputs, components etc.)Deploy and embed dashboards without any manual no-code edits (or, deploy to your workspace and iterate using the no-code builder)

  5. Add Advanced Event Tracking

    It would be useful for a lot of folks if they were able to view / capture / track more events in Embeddable than strictly those that can be assigned to variables via Embeddable Events. For example, clicks on a bar chart axis, drop-down clicks and selections, link clicks or table clicks, etc. Can we expose more component events in a way that allows users to tie their existing analytics solutions (eg MixPanel) into Embeddable and monitor more interactions?
